Rates & Terms
In Waukesha, lenders evaluate your employment history, credit utilization, and payment history to determine your personal loan rate.
Personal loan rates in Waukesha typically range from 6.99% to 35.99% APR depending on your credit score, income, and debt-to-income ratio.
Requirements in Waukesha
Most lenders serving Waukesha, WI require a minimum credit score of 600, verifiable income of at least $24,000 annually, and a debt-to-income ratio below 45%.
Lenders in Waukesha prefer borrowers with stable employment history; however, some online lenders accept alternative income sources.

Borrowing Tips for Waukesha
- Set up autopay to qualify for rate discounts; many lenders offer 0.25% to 0.50% APR reductions for automatic payments.
- Consider a co-signer if your credit is borderline; a qualified co-signer can significantly improve your approval odds and rate.
- Avoid payday loans in WI; personal loans offer longer terms, lower rates, and better consumer protections.
